Output dfb629aaa460159b1782135ee6a605ca3ae7febd7998be67d7937f837fbbb4f1:109

value
49331
script pubkey
OP_0 OP_PUSHBYTES_20 50bbf4b6112173f850e15686ceb3ddddf768a6a1
address
bc1q2zalfds3y9els58p26rvav7amhmk3f4pw3fe8l
transaction
dfb629aaa460159b1782135ee6a605ca3ae7febd7998be67d7937f837fbbb4f1